One of America’s Oldest Cheesemakers Could Be Yours—for $2.5 Million

One among America’s oldest small companies is up on the market. It may very well be yours—in case you have sufficient cheddar.
Crowley Cheese, based mostly in Healdville, Vt., has been round for greater than 200 years, and the property of Galen Jones and his spouse Jill Jones for the previous 16. Now the corporate is on the block, with Galen, who’s 68, able to step away from the enterprise of churning out handcrafted artisanal American cheese.
“I am an previous man, and I’m able to retire,” he mentioned.
The asking value, $2.5 million, would get a purchaser the manufacturing facility, about 16 acres of surrounding land, cheesemaking tools, the model, and a few 50,000 kilos of aged cheese. The enterprise, which employs 5 folks, is “rising and worthwhile,” based on Galen Jones.
A purchaser would additionally get the recipe for Crowley’s cheese, described as having yogurt-like qualities that distinguish it from different cheddars. It sells in blocks and wheels; an 8-ounce block begins at $10, whereas a 2.5 pound wheels begins at $50.
Making Cheese ‘Is Not For Everybody’
The Crowley facility, which is taken into account Vermont’s oldest energetic cheese manufacturing facility and one of many oldest within the nation, produces 30,000 to 40,000 kilos of aged cheddar cheese yearly utilizing a recipe that hasn’t modified since 1824. Its cheese is shipped nationwide from Healdville, a few 150-mile drive northwest of Boston.
The Joneses purchased Crowley Cheese in 2009. Galen Jones knew individuals who have been a part of the earlier investor group, he mentioned, and occurred to cross paths with the lead investor whereas working in digital media. (He declined to reveal the acquisition value.) Reminded of the enterprise, he appeared it up on-line.
“We had a fairly horrible economic system in 2009, and Crowley Cheese was additionally struggling,” Jones mentioned. Unable to cease fascinated by it, he reached out to the homeowners and shortly visited the manufacturing facility.
“Six weeks after that, my spouse and I have been working this singular enterprise, which was a easy manufacturing facility in the midst of the countryside,” he mentioned. “It was serendipity, if you’ll.”
The “manufacturing facility,” a two-story historic farmhouse inbuilt 1882 the place cheese is handmade utilizing uncooked milk with no components or preservatives, features a retailer and is open to guests. The Joneses renovated the property and labored to enhance manufacturing processes.
Jones mentioned he’s acquired loads of inquiries concerning the enterprise since asserting its availability earlier this month. “Some individuals are within the thought however not effectively geared up to tackle the enterprise,” he mentioned. “With others, there’s severe curiosity.”
The best purchaser, he mentioned, can be somebody who may take “what we’ve been doing for the final 16 years to the following stage,” he mentioned. “Cheesemaking shouldn’t be for everybody. From my standpoint, it’s crucial we discover possession that may efficiently take the enterprise ahead.”

AAA Sees Record Number of Americans Traveling Domestically July 4th Week

The American Vehicle Affiliation is anticipating a file variety of Individuals to journey throughout the U.S. throughout the Independence Day vacation interval.
AAA is projecting 72.2 million folks to journey no less than 50 miles from residence between Saturday, June 28, and Sunday, July 6. That will symbolize 1.7 million extra vacationers from final yr and seven million greater than in 2019.
“With the vacation falling on a Friday, vacationers have the choice of constructing it an extended weekend or taking the complete week to make reminiscences with household and associates,” AAA Journey Vice President Stacey Barber stated.
AAA is anticipating file journey by each automotive and air. It stated it tasks 61.6 million folks to journey by automotive, up 2.2% from final yr, and 5.84 million vacationers to fly, up 1.4%. It stated 8% of all Independence Day vacationers are anticipated to fly.
Boosting automotive journey are gasoline costs that “are nonetheless the bottom they’ve been since 2021” regardless that the Iran-Israel battle has elevated the worth of oil in current days, AAA stated. “Escalation and length of the battle are two components to observe. Climate can be a wild card.”
